Abstract

Electro galvanized steel is electroplated cold roller steel for improving corrosion resistance and paintability, and is widely used in automobiles and home appliances. In the electroplating line for manufacturing electro galvanized steel if plating process is carried out with impurity on conductor roll surface, the defects in manufacturing process occurs because of steel fault. For quality, polishing is always required to separate impurity on surface of conductor roll. In this study, finite element analysis of wear for polisher brush is carried out for replaced time of it.
